Maintenance Manager (CNC)

£50,000 - £55,000 + 33 days' holiday + contributory pension

Coventry, West Midlands

Are you a Maintenance Manager from a CNC machining background, looking to put your own stamp on the maintenance department at a leading manufacturer that is investing heavily in the site?

On offer is the opportunity to lead all maintenance activities and implement improvements at a multi-million-pound site, with further planned investments.

This company is an international manufacturer. They are renowned for the quality of their products, and customer service. They are part of a global group. They have significantly invested in their site, with further improvements planned.

This is an exciting opportunity and varied position where you will manage all aspects of maintenance at the site, implementing new process and some hands on activities.

The role would suit a Maintenance Manager from a CNC machining background, looking for an autonomous role at a leading manufacturer.

The role:

· Implement new maintenance systems

· Manage maintenance budgets and training schedules

· Days Based, Monday to Friday

The person:

· Maintenance Manager

· CNC Machining background

· Looking to work for an industry leading manufacturer
